Analysis
Hong Kong, China recorded -3.47 % change on previous year for population ages 30-34, female, annual growth rate in 2025.
That represents a change of up 6.1% on the previous year and down 493.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, population ages 30-34, female, annual growth rate in Hong Kong, China peaked at 18.58 % change on previous year in 1979 and was at its lowest, -21.76 % change on previous year, in 1968.
Hong Kong, China ranks 192nd of 218 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
The year-on-year percentage change in Population ages 30-34, female. Computed from consecutive annual observations; years either side of a gap are skipped rather than bridged.
Computed from
- Population ages 30-34, female World Bank staff estimates using the World Bank's total population and age/sex distributions of the United Nations Population Division's World Population Prospects
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
